The steel drum you really struggled to get through is to be replaced by a plastic tube, and I consider it dodgey.
I normally belay to the rail and back up with the bolts.
Its 60 feet to a landing of sorts and a way off over blind stope to collapse at Western Engine Shaft.
Another 60 feet of vertical to another landing. I used a single 40 metre rope.
A 30 foot vertical to the bottom of the stope at second landing. Rise at the stope end leads to short railed passage to more collapse at WES.
Part of the stope bottom was running downwards, scaffs lying around were to be used in a dig there.
